2024 Annual Conference:
Hand in Hand: Language & Culture in the Classroom
#FLENJAC24
FLENJ will host our Annual Conference
on March 13, 2024
Join us for excellent, forward-thinking professional development hosted by Rutgers University in New Brunswick, NJ. We are pleased to share that our Keynote Speaker will be Allison Perryman!
At #FLENJAC24, you will be able to choose from many interactive, engaging sessions that pique your interest and meet your needs. Registering for the event also allows you to participate in great networking opportunities, our annual business meeting, and the student and teacher awards ceremony.
